Ryzen 7 8700G | SpecificationsComparison of all specifications | Core i9-9900KF |
---|---|---|
General | ||
Jan 8th, 2024 | Release Date | Jan 8th, 2019 |
$329.00 | MSRP | $488.00 |
Desktop | Segment | Desktop |
AMD Socket AM5 | Socket | Intel Socket 1151 |
Not Available | Codename | Coffee Lake |
65 W | Power Consumption | 95 W |
Performance | ||
8 | Cores | 8 |
16 | Threads | 16 |
4.2 GHz | Base Frequency | 3.6 GHz |
5.1 GHz | Turbo Frequency | 5.0 GHz |
16 MB | L3 Cache | 16 MB |
Other Features | ||
DDR5 @ 5200 MHz | RAM | DDR4 @ 2666 MHz |
Radeon 780M | Integrated Graphics | No |
Yes | Overclockable | Yes |
